Radscorpions are mutated arachnids found in the Mojave Wasteland in 2281.

Contents

BackgroundEdit

Main article: Radscorpion

Radscorpions are mutated, via radiation and exposure to the FEV virus, from the North American Emperor scorpion,[1][2] which were prolific in many pet stores at the time of the Great War.[3]

Contrary to many expectations, their venom grew more potent when they mutated rather than becoming diluted. Though considered nocturnal and sensitive to light, radscorpions can be found active during the daytime in the areas they inhabit. Samples of their venom can be used to make antivenom. Apart from their size, they appear visually identical to normal scorpions, with mottled, dark, blueish grey carapaces.

CharacteristicsEdit

BiologyEdit

Radscorpions are very large, around the size of a bighorner calf, and have a thick carapace covering their entire body, with no definitive weak spot. Common places to find radscorpions are Scorpion Gulch, the scorpion burrow, the scorpion valley near Goodsprings cemetery and the Yangtze Memorial. The area around Nipton Road Reststop and Mesquite Mountains camp site is also inhabited by large numbers of radscorpions.

Gameplay attributesEdit

As radscorpions almost always move in groups between two and five individuals, they can be very dangerous to low level players. Also the addition of DT makes them hard to kill for an unprepared player. They attack head on, with no discernible tactics.

Radscorpions take normal damage when shot in the torso, stinger, or claws, and reduced damage when shot in the legs. Unlike other creatures, radscorpions lack a "weak point" that can be targeted for extra damage (they have no "head" to headshot), which makes V.A.T.S. combat and firearms somewhat less effective against them. On top of this all radscorpions are armored to some extent which makes them even more difficult to kill.

One suggested tactic is to target the claws, which are strangely less-armored than the rest of the carapace- successfully crippling a claw will stun it long enough to either finish it off, cripple the other claw to stun it again, or cripple their legs if the player wishes to continue attacking at range. If using Guns, armor-piercing rounds are highly suggested and slug rounds are an excellent alternative to armor piercing rounds (especially if combined with the Shotgun Surgeon perk). If attacking with Melee Weapons, crippling the tail is highly recommended to prevent poisonous attacks. Players at the beginning of the game will also have extreme difficulty, as pistols and shotguns do little against them, so it's recommended to simply cripple one of their legs and run away till they lose interest.

Giant radscorpionEdit

Giant radscorpion.png

A larger and much more dangerous variant of radscorpion that is faster, as well as rarer than the usual radscorpion. It does a lot more damage and has a higher Damage Threshold (on par with that of a sentry bot), making them particularly difficult to kill for low level or otherwise poorly equipped players.

Giant radscorpions can be found anywhere that radscorpions will gather or can be found solitary.

BugsEdit

  • When viewed from a distance, the radscorpion(s) frequently slide vertically across uneven terrain, and can possibly sink into the ground making it near impossible to kill them. If the Courier is unable to kill the sunken radscorpion, it remains as a red tick indicating an enemy on the radar, making it also impossible to leave the area by fast travel.
  • Due to their low position to the ground (as well with giant ants), radscorpions tend to clip under the terrain when dead, making their legs and claws stretch and flail, possibly causing lag and even freezes during play.
